Truck Accidents
Commercial trucks account for a high number of fatalities and injuries on California's roadways despite being a small percentage of the registered vehicles. Their weight and size can cause serious damage to passenger cars in the event of a collision. This can cause serious injuries and can have a long-term impact on the person who was injured.
Many truck accidents result from driver errors. If the truck driver was negligent and liable, they could be held accountable for any damages suffered by victims. The employer of a trucker may also be liable for the crash based on whether the trucker was an independent contractor or an employee of the motor carrier company.
Compensation for victims should cover economic and non-economic losses, regardless of who is the cause of the incident. Economic damages may include medical expenses or lost income, damage to property, as well as future expenses that might be the responsibility of a victim. Non-economic damages include suffering and pain and loss of consortium and emotional distress.

DMV Hearings
You could be able to contest any traffic ticket during an DMV Hearing. These are administrative hearings where one DMV official, known as a hearing officer determines if the evidence offered is sufficient to cancel your license. Hearing officers are not judges and don't have to be lawyers, but they are trained on how to evaluate evidence. Therefore, they are far more likely to consider well-reasoned legal arguments against drivers when the arguments are provided by a skilled DMV defense lawyer.
The attorney may subpoena the officer who wrote the citation or the police department if they didn't write the ticket, to appear at the hearing and give evidence of what they observed. Your lawyer can also request all relevant records via discovery from DMV and include any dashcam footage or other evidence of the incident.
Drivers do not have the right to a DMV lawyer since these hearings are administrative, and not criminal.
